摘要

针对萤火虫算法(FA)复杂度大,对高维函数优化困难,容易陷入局部极小值等问题,提出了基于拓扑改进与交叉策略的萤火虫算法。该算法用冯诺依曼拓扑结构来模拟萤火虫之间的邻域结构,提高了全局搜索能力,并且减小了计算复杂度。同时,引入自适应交叉策略,根据萤火虫的多样性动态的调整交叉概率,增强了萤火虫跳出局部最优的能力。对8个标准测试函数的仿真实验表明,改进后的萤火虫算法与标准萤火虫算法相比,有更高的收敛精度和稳定性。